Marcus Beard Obituary

Beard, Marcus Howard 57, of Chicago, Illinois made his transition on September 20, 2011. In 2009, Mr. Beard was diagnosed with prostate cancer, to which he eventually succumbed. Marcus was born in Chicago, Illinois on March 26, 1954. Marcus graduated from Central YMCA High School and received his B.A. in May 2011 from Chicago State University. He married Tiffany Armstrong Beard in 2009. Marcus began his career in telecommunications with Illinois Bell and Ameritech and worked as an investor for the past 15 years. Marcus was an avid audiophile, enjoyed downhill skiing, and collecting art. He was an active member of the Chicago Audio Society, Sno-Gophers Ski Club, Porsche Club of America and American Association of Individual Investors. He is survived by his loving wife, Tiffany of Chicago, IL. He is predeceased by William Beard; father, Dorothy P. Beard; mother and William L. Beard; brother.
